Thousand's Avatar
Old (#12)
thanks, lotet! i will add the armor/paint thing in the face, thanks for reminding me!

i want to do the lowres now as quick as possible (where the hell did pixologic put the transparency/backface settings for retopology using zspheres????) and then tweak head and everything else using the lowres, at least that´s the plan.

also zbrush keeps crashing during retopo, i might have to do it in maya...

it´s really a shame that pixo won´t provide a proper documentation as well as these so important basic functions like backface culling adjustments for retopo...

edit: the transparency/backface settings for retopology using zspheres are placed within the preferences>draw menu

Thousand's Avatar
Old (#24)
Hi

@ Evanescfan: The character consists of 26 separate geometries; since I wanted to create a very detailled shape, I had a lot of extrusions (decorations etc.) for which I had to cut apart the UV-shells. But I have to admit, I like creating UV-layouts ;); but I changed the daggers in the last moment, so it is not as efficient as it could be.

Somehow I was not able to get a controllable effect from the glossmap with marmoset; I guess, I also was a bit worn out already, so I will push texturing and glossmap stuff next time.
